Transaction 564688efc2759abbc3b7db16426b34edd8895606968448f352ee001f451df171
1 Input
1 Output
-
564688efc2759abbc3b7db16426b34edd8895606968448f352ee001f451df171:0
- value
- 299421
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4fb5c23753fbf5e4c90c29140e4e681d0f81e56 OP_EQUAL
- address
- 3KeZUwDpQtw7v6TAzUznKZroVcLHQnFWau